I would like to clear up one matter which got a little bit loose yesterday. On a reading of Section 14, if the Minister's interpretation is right there, taking "holders" by itself, as the Minister suggested, I think the better opinion would be that Section 14 does impose a new type of power of suspension or does give a new type of power to the local authority by order. It does not actually give the power but it provides that the Minister may give such power and then any power that was in the local authority under Section 27 is removed by Section 18 which we were discussing. That seems to be clear on the drafting.
There are two points that arise. The first is the objectionable form of the drafting of Section 18. We have disposed of that. The second is the matter of the principle: Is it desirable to do precisely what the Minister wants to do here?
